ALUMINA MAGNESIA CARBON BRICK FOR LADLE
Its made from bauxite,fused alumina,fused magnesia and high carbon content graphite as main material,bonding with phenolic resin and pressing under high pressure.It has lower apparent porosity,good slag corrosion resistance,good scouring resistance,especially improving of spalling resistance and slag resistance while the spinel's forming during the period of ladle operation,mainly used in sidewall and bottom of the ladle.
Item | Index | ||
AMC-65 | AMC-70 | ||
ω(Al₂O₃)/% ≥ | 65 | 70 | |
ω(MgO)/% ≥ | 11 | 11 | |
ω(C)/% ≥ | 9 | 9 | |
%A.P ≤ | 8 | 6 | |
(g/cm³)B.D ≥ | 2.98 | 3.00 | |
MPa C.C.S ≥ | 40 | 45 | |
Application | Side wall,bottom | Critical area of side wall,bottom |
INSULATING CASTABLE FOR LADLE
It's made from bauxite clinker,fused alumina and high purity dead burned magnesia as main material,mixing with appropriate special additives and binder.The various kinds of castable could meet requirements from different customers.
Features: convenient construction, good corrosion resistance, longer service life, lower consumption per ton steel. A developing trend of ladle refractory.

ALUMINA SELF-FLOW CASTABLE
It's made from alumina as aggregate,mixing with some additives and high-alumina cement as binder.It has good refractoriness, good corrosion resistance,good scouring resistance,strong strength,mainly used in quick-wearing parts of the various kinds of thermal kiln and furnace.
Item | Index | ||
ZL-1 | ZL-2 | ||
ω(Al₂O₃)/% ≥ | 93 | 93 | |
ω(SiO₂)/% ≤ | 0.5 | 1.0 | |
ω(CaO)1% ≤ | 2.0 | 2.0 | |
MPa C.C.S ≥ | 110℃×24h | 80 | 60 |
1500℃×3h | 120 | 100 | |
MPa MOR ≥ | 110℃×24h | 8 | 6 |
1500℃×3h | 10 | 9 | |
(1500℃×3h)/%PLC | ±0.5 | ±0.5 | |
/℃ REF ≥ | 1800 | 1800 |
